Description

As a partner to businesses and governments,Crane Authenticationoffers expertise and cutting-edge innovations that protect and enhance products, secure identities, safeguard revenues and enforce compliance. Customers from different business sectors and levels of government trust our team of 1,250 people for their expertise in R&D, security design, engineering and data-driven insights. We are an integral part ofCrane NXT, a $2 billion dollar business with over 5,000 associates

As part of our growth we are looking for aSenior Software Engineer in Bangalore, Indiawhereyou will be part of a globalauthenticationteam fighting fraud and piracy!

Role Summary:

As a Senior Software Engineer, you will form part of a cross-functional, multi-disciplinary Agile product team for one of our key products. We are passionate about writing good quality, highly testable, user-driven software. What’s most important is a solid understanding of Engineering principles and practices and a desire to learn.

KEY ACCOUNTABILITY

  • Collaborate and review requirements proposed by the Product Owner / Business Analyst to understand, document, estimate, design, implement, and unit test viable software solutions
  • Design and implement services and APIs supporting applications using microservice architecture for application development or data services
  • Develop solid, scalable information systems that support the continuously evolving needs of our clients and internal operational teams
  • Ensure that information systems scale and support new features for delivery
  • Modify existing software to fix bugs, adapt to new requirements and improve performance
  • Maintain code quality, test coverage and code reviews following standard guidelines
  • Collaborate with multi-disciplinary team members to ensure timely delivery of commitments.
  • Continuously drive improvement with yourself, the team and the department through ways of working with more agility and introducing new technologies.
  • Promote knowledge sharing across the team and department, ensuring that we work as closely and effectively as possible.
  • Act as point of contact for escalations and crucial stakeholder requests.

Skills & Knowledge:

  • Demonstrated ability to deliver high-quality, enterprise-class software on-time and of high quality
  • Good knowledgeable in the software development lifecycle
  • Working knowledge of source control systems like Git
  • Experience working in Agile-oriented teams, especially SCRUM or Kanban
  • Possess good communication skills in English, both written and verbal (for non-English speaking countries)
  • Very strong problem-solving skills and algorithm knowledge
  • Good technical skills with knowledge of solution design and application architecture

Experience:

  • Programming framework/language: Java 8 and higher, Spring Boot.
  • Databases: Any SQL DB and MongoDB.
  • Experience using and developing Restful APIs.
  • Experience with AWS SQS, Elastic search service, EC2, RDS, S3, ELB, CloudWatch.
  • Experience with messaging and streaming platforms (RabbitMQ), cloud computing (ideally AWS) and experience with caching technologies (Memcached, Redis, ElastiCache).
  • Experience in automating build deployments, Continuous Integration and Continuous Delivery.

Crane Authentication is part of Crane NXT

Crane NXT is a premier industrial technology company that provides proprietary and trusted technology solutions to secure, detect, and authenticate what matters most to its customers. Crane NXT has approximately 5,000 employees with global operations and manufacturing facilities in the United States, the United Kingdom, Mexico, Japan, Switzerland, Germany, Sweden, and Malta.
